Output 26e1bd7421ef2d4072445217f3ca304673e659f1bf7e7979776af788e5457195: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 357ece2e6793d18e3a23369774d24e47a89f8394 OP_EQUAL
address
36ZseJbHLidgKb9ghKHuzC15TPAjbh9niV
transaction
26e1bd7421ef2d4072445217f3ca304673e659f1bf7e7979776af788e5457195
confirmations
168953
spent
true